Spanish Language and Hispanic Ministry Intensive
Lutheran Seminary Program in the Southwest will be hosting their Spanish Language and Hispanic Ministry Intensive on May 24-29, 2015.
The Intensive is a resource for Lutherans and those of other denominations who recognize the growing need for competency in the Spanish language and an understanding of Hispanic culture in light of the increasing Hispanic population in this country and in the church. The course focuses on the study of the Spanish language and on different aspects of Hispanic culture, ranging from cuisine to dancing.

New! Level II Intensive
Building Congregational Capacity for Hispanic Ministry:
Misión en Comunidad/Mission in Community
This new Level II Intensive is designed for congregational leaders in those congregations where consideration is being given to starting Hispanic Ministry in their community. Teams from congregations are encouraged to attend. During this week teams will learn:
- To increase capacity for doing Hispanic ministry
- To learn several models for engaging in Hispanic ministry in congregational settings
- To improve facility in Spanish language, especially liturgical Spanish
- To build a cohort of colleagues preparing for Hispanic ministry within their community
The main presenter is the Rev. Rubén Durán with several outstanding guests sharing models for Hispanic Ministry.

Worship Jubilee of the Evangelical Lutheran Church in America
Biennial Conference of the Association of Lutheran Church Musicians
July 19-21, 2105 • Atlanta, GA
How is God calling the church today? And to what are Christians called?
For the first time, this gathering brings together two major national events in overlapping conferences: the Association of Lutheran Church Musicians will meet Sunday through Wednesday of this week. The third Worship Jubilee for the Evangelical Lutheran Church in America, following those held in 2000 and 2007, will meet Monday through Thursday.
Participants may register for one or both events, which will feature leading voices, practical workshops, diverse worship expressions in several of Atlanta’s city churches, and rich conversation. Visit LivingVoice2015.org for more information.
